Unacceptable – Ian Wright criticizes Sterling as Arsenal beat Leicester

Arsenal legend, Ian Wright has criticized Raheem Sterling over his ‘unacceptable’ display in Arsenal’s Premier League 2-0 win against Leicester City on Saturday.

Two second-half goals from Mikel Merino gave Arsenal all three points against Leicester at the King Power Stadium.

The result leaves Arsenal four points behind Premier League leaders Liverpool in the table.

However, Wright was not happy with Sterling after he was caught offside on two occasions during the encounter despite being able to clearly see the Leicester’s defensive line.

Sterling was eventually replaced by Merino in the 69th minute.

“I think Nwaneri has been exceptional in that front three,” Wright told Premier League Productions during his half-time analysis.

“Raheem Sterling and Trossard… I think Trossard had a good chance, the kind of chance in a game with the forwards we’ve got you’ve got to do more with it, go to the basics in trying to get contact on it, he didn’t do that.

“That is unacceptable, that one there [from Sterling]. Unacceptable, he’s on the line, he can see the whole line, he’s got space, you pull your hair out as a manager.”

Arsenal’s next fixture is against West Ham United next weekend.
